2021 HSC: Merit Lists and Results
In 2021, 66,710 students were awarded the Higher School Certificate and 54, 847 students were eligible for an ATAR. A further 8,782 students completed one or more HSC courses.
Data as at 15 January 2022
OVERALL
- In 2021, 66,710 students were awarded the Higher School Certificate and 54, 847 students were eligible for an ATAR. A further 8,782 students completed one or more HSC courses.
- 99% of students achieved the HSC minimum standard
COURSES
- 46% completed English Standard, 36% English Advanced, 12% English Studies, 3% English as an Additional Language/Dialect and 3% English Life Skills
- 84% completed a Mathematics course
- 47% completed a Science course
- 27% completed a Vocational Education and Training (VET) course
- 8% completed a Language course
- 3% completed a Life Skills course
PERFORMANCE
- Indicating the hard work that the Class of 2021 put into their HSC, 12% of all course results were in the top band (Band 6 or E4), 41% in the top two bands, and 70% in the top three bands.
- 97% of course results were at or above the Minimum Standard Expected (at least Band 2 or E2)
- These percentages are consistent with previous years.
- 139 students achieved First in Course
- There were 1,476 All-round Achievers, who were on the Distinguished Achievers List for at least 10 units of study.
- 786 students achieved one of the top places and a result in the highest band in one or more HSC courses and were awarded the Top Achievers Award.
- 17,820 students were recognised on the Distinguished Achievers list with 39,443 Band 6 or E4 course results
Special consideration
- Over 13,000 students from around 350 schools received an upheld Special Considerations application
- More detailed Special Consideration data will be released by mid year as part of the 2021 HSC Fairness and Integrity data
HSC minimum standard
- Less than one per cent (586) of students, otherwise eligible for the HSC, did not meet the HSC minimum standard.
- Of the students who did not meet the minimum standard:
- 106 (18%) are yet to achieve the reading standard
- 429 (73%) are yet to achieve the writing standard
- 310 (53%) are yet to achieve the numeracy standard.
- Of the students who were awarded the HSC, 3% were exempt from meeting the HSC minimum standard.
